    Deciphering Uncommon Financial Terms

    When you come across unfamiliar financial terms like IIOSCTickersc, here’s how to approach it:

    • Identify the source: Determine where you found the term. Look for clues within the document, data feed, or conversation. The source of the term provides critical context. This will help you find the meaning.
    • Context analysis: Pay attention to the surrounding text. What is the topic? What other financial terms are used? What is the date? The context often gives hints about the term's meaning.
    • Search: Use search engines to look for the term. Put the term in quotes. Search for related terms too. Look for related articles or documents to help clarify the term.
    • Check Financial Resources: Consult financial dictionaries, glossaries, or databases. These resources can help you understand industry jargon.
    • Consult Experts: If you are still confused, ask a financial professional or expert. They may have insight into the term. Asking an expert is a great idea to clarify the meaning.
